Hi, and thanks for your interest in my series of improvisational jams.
_ What I like to do with my writing technique is I like _ as much improvisational material as I can.
Using _ groups of loops or any kind of inspirational patterns.
I _ _ _ _ found a lot of nice arpeggiation patches with the Korg X-50.
_ _ And of course you can always use anything that you have at home. _
_ _ _ _ _ _ _ _
And everything comes these days with that possibility.
So you can always set yourself up [N] with a pattern that's got a nice feel to it.
So most of the time I use percussion.
But the _ main thing is that if it feels good it's going to inspire improvisation.
It's going to inspire something that makes you want to play.
That's what I go for. _ _ _
_ _ _ _ _ Because there's no reading involved and there's no sitting down and racking your brains.
_ _ _ _ You know, place things.
Just do what comes naturally.
Do what you hear.
Feel what you hear and hear what you feel.
_ _ _ _ This is what I do.
The next piece is I started yesterday in my control room, drum room, with my keyboard set up.
I used my _ _ _ _ Korg 16 Strummer or something like that.
Anyway, it's a really neat program.
_ I [Em] just plotted out chords as they came to me and hit bass lines as they came to me.
